Proper nouns of invention refer to specific names given to unique creations or innovations, such as brand names, trademarks, or patented products. Examples include "iPhone" for Apple's smartphone, "Kleenex" for facial tissues, and "Post-it Notes" for sticky notes made by 3M. These names not only identify the products but also often become synonymous with the category they represent, influencing consumer perception and usage. Proper nouns of invention are integral to branding and marketing strategies.
